"Introduction: Vigorous physical exertion, such as a marathon, evokes long lasting changes in the autonomic cardiac regulation and peripheral fatigue. Aim of the study: We investigated changes in the autonomic nervous system (ANS) activity simultaneously with subjective feeling of the fatigue for the 67 hours following a marathon (42.195 km) in 31 years old male amateur athlete. Methods: The ANS activity was assessed by spectral analysis of heart rate variability (SA HRV) during orto-clinostatics maneuvers. Both frequency-domain measures and age-dependent complex indexes of the SA HRV were used. Post-race ANS activity was assess at the beginning of the 7th, the 19th, the 34th, the 44th, the 58th, and the 67th hour of the recovery period. Results: At the 19th hour after the race, the overall spectral power had risen above the initial level, primarily owing to the prevailing sympathetic activity over the increasing vagal activity.
